Whataburger is a well-established American fast-food restaurant chain known for its commitment to quality food and outstanding customer service. Founded in 1950, Whataburger has grown into a beloved brand primarily located in the Southern United States, known for its distinctive five-sided orange-and-white striped A-frame buildings and its delicious, made-to-order burgers. Its focus on creating a unique family-oriented dining experience has earned it a loyal customer base and a strong reputation in the fast-food industry. Job Duties

  • Manages front-of-house restaurant operations including staff scheduling customer service and presentation of the dining room and bar areas
  • Manages the kitchen team to ensure timely and quality food delivery and resolve service issues
  • Hires trains and retains talent to deliver extraordinary customer service
  • Conducts regular inventory checks and order restaurant supplies as required to ensure adequate stock levels and prevent stock-outs
  • Ensures profitability for restaurant working with Operating Partners on financial reports and budget management
  • Provides guidance on cleaning sanitation and food safety procedures
  • Ensures compliance with health and safety regulations and training
